The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Batten, born in 1847 in Ubley, Somerset, consisted of 6 members. James was the head of the household, married to Mary Batten, born in 1853 in Wrington, Somerset, England. They had 1 child; William H, born 1878 in Compton Martin, Somerset, England.
During the period, also present in the household were James's Son Daughter, Rosa E (born 1880 in Compton Martin, Somerset, England), James's Servant, David (born 1867 in Chew Stoke, Somerset, England) and James's Servant, Kate (born 1868 in Winford, Somerset, England).
